  18. I think it's really hard to compare spin rate for previous years. MLB has messed with the baseball also in other years . If the seams are higher pitchers can get a better grip. If the seams are lower they start using more sticky stuff. Also if the ball is slightly lighter or heavier or the core is changed that affects pitchers too. Pitcher's return from injuries , change mechanics ,move from starter to reliever . One size does not fit all. The picture is to big to paint with a broad brush. Let's face it baseball always wants more offense and the latest crackdown on sticky substances and ball changes plus all the studies on moving the mound back are all designed for the benefit of the offense. Supposedly they made the ball lighter this year because of the inordinate number of HR's last year so that combined with the sticky stuff has led to offenses being down this year. It's just hard to pinpoint when and how prevalent the sticky stuff became a big thing. Did it really gain momentum last year throughout the league when everyone was smashing the ball or were the new and improve substances mostly unavailable until last year ? Some have been around a while but perhaps closely guarded secrets . Things like that don't stay secrets long and once guys started ratting it was already at epidemic proportions. So somewhere between the secret getting out and the manufacturing of the substances in abundance the ball got changed and then it became the next steroids type performance enhancing issue which the league wants to put down as fast as they can.
